Abstract

A measure of similarity between an identifier of a sender of the message and each identifier of one or more identifiers of each trusted contact of a plurality of trusted contacts of a recipient of the message is determined. In the event the sender of the message is not any of the trusted contacts but at least one of the measure of similarity between the identifier of the sender of the message and a selected identifier of a selected trusted contact of the plurality of trusted contacts meets a threshold, the message is modified, if applicable, to alter content of a data field that includes an identification of the sender of the message. The data field is one of a plurality of data fields included in a header of the message.

Claims (40)

1. A method, comprising:

determining a measure of trust associated with a sender of a message;

determining a measure of similarity between an identifier of the sender of the message and each identifier of one or more identifiers of each trusted contact of a plurality of trusted contacts of a recipient of the message;

determining a measure of spoofing risk associated with the sender;

combining, at a system that includes one or more servers, the measure of similarity with at least one of the measure of trust or the measure of spoofing risk to determine a combined measure of risk associated with the message, wherein the sender of the message is not any of the trusted contacts but at least one of the measure of similarity between the identifier of the sender of the message and a selected identifier of a selected trusted contact of the plurality of trusted contacts meets a threshold; and

based at least in part on the combined measure of risk associated with the message, modifying, at the system that includes the one or more servers, the message to alter content of a data field that includes an identification of the sender of the message, wherein the data field is one of a plurality of data fields included in a header of the message.

2. The method of claim 1 , wherein modifying the message to alter the content of the data field that includes the identification of the sender includes modifying a sender email address or a reply-to address of the message.

3. The method of claim 1 , wherein modifying the message to alter the content of the data field that includes the identification of the sender includes modifying a display name of the sender of the message.

4. The method of claim 1 , wherein modifying the message to alter the content of the data field that includes the identification of the sender includes modifying a phone number or a link to an image of the sender of the message.

5. The method of claim 1 , wherein the data field is a “From:” field of the header of the message.

6. The method of claim 1 , wherein modifying the message to alter the content of the data field that includes the identification of the sender includes deleting the identification of the sender of the message prior to delivering the message to the recipient of the message.

7. The method of claim 1 , wherein determining the measure of similarity includes sorting elements of the identifier of the sender and sorting elements of the selected identifier of the selected trusted contact.

8. The method of claim 1 , wherein determining the measure of similarity includes determining a string similarity measure between the identifier of the sender and the selected identifier of the selected trusted contact.

9. The method of claim 1 , wherein determining the measure of similarity includes detecting substitution characters in the identifier of the sender.

10. The method of claim 1 , wherein the identifier of the sender includes an email address or a display name of the sender and the selected identifier of the selected trusted contact includes an email address or a display name of the selected trusted contact.

11. The method of claim 1 , wherein the plurality of trusted contacts of the recipient was identified at least in part by the recipient of the message.

12. The method of claim 1 , wherein the plurality of trusted contacts of the recipient was identified at least in part based on contacts included an address book of the recipient of the message.

13. The method of claim 1 , wherein the plurality of trusted contacts of the recipient was automatically identified at least in part by analyzing previous messages sent and received by the recipient.

14. The method of claim 1 , wherein the plurality of trusted contacts of the recipient was identified at least in part by analyzing previous messages sent and received by a plurality of different message accounts of a same network domain of the recipient.

15. The method of claim 1 , wherein the selected identifier of the selected trusted contact was obtained from a subject field of the message.

16. The method of claim 1 , further comprising:

determining a first measure of reputation associated with the sender;

determining a second measure of reputation associated with the sender, wherein the first measure of reputation is associated with a longer timer period than the second measure of reputation; and

detecting a change in the second measure of reputation in light of the first measure of reputation, wherein the message is filtered based at least in part on the detected change.

17. The method of claim 1 , further comprising determining a measure of control of a network domain of the sender the message, wherein the message is filtered based at least in part on the measure of control of the network domain.

18. The method of claim 1 , wherein the spoofing risk is based at least in part a message validation policy associated with a network domain of the sender.
